An automobile club reported that the average price of regular gasoline in a certain state was $2.61 per gallon. The following data show the price per gallon of regular gasoline for 15 randomly selected stations in the state. Complete parts a through c below.

2.64

2.72

2.53

2.65

2.57

2.69

2.62

2.51

2.65

2.63

2.56

2.51

2.66

2.62

2.65

a.

Construct a 99​% confidence interval to estimate the average price per gallon of gasoline in the state.

The 99% confidence interval to estimate the average price per gallon of gasoline in the state is from $_____to $_____

b. Do the results from this sample validate the automobile​ club's findings?

A. Since the population​ mean, ​$2.61​, is not contained within the 95​% confidence​ interval, it can be said with 95​% confidence that the sample validates the automobile​ club's findings.

B. Since the population​ mean, ​$2.61​, is contained within the 95​% confidence​ interval, it can be said with 95​% confidence that the sample validates the automobile​ club's findings.

C. Since the population​ mean, ​$2.61​, is not contained within the 95​% confidence​ interval, it can be said with 95​% confidence that the sample does not validate the automobile​ club's findings.

D. Since the population​ mean, ​$2.61​, is contained within the 95​% confidence​ interval, it can be said with 95​% confidence that the sample does not validate the automobile​ club's findings.

c. What assumptions need to be made about this​ population?

A. The only assumption needed is that the population standard deviation is known.

B. The only assumption needed is that the population distribution is approximately uniform.

C. The only assumption needed is that the population distribution is approximately normal.

D. No assumptions are required.

Solution:- Given that samples : 2.64,2.72,2.53,2.65,2.57,2.69,2.62,2.51,2.65,2.63,2.56,2.51,2.66,2.62,2.65

X = 2.614, s = 0.0641, n = 15, df = 14, t = 2.977

a. 99% confidence interval for the avergae price per gallon of gasonline :
X +/- t*s/sqrt(n)

= 2.614 +/- 2.977*0.0641/sqrt(15)
= (2.5647,2.6633)

b. option B.

c. option C.
